FAST RECOVERY RECTIFIERS
FEATURES
Fast switching for high efficiency
Low cost
Diffused junction
Low reverse leakage current
Low forward voltage drop
High current capability
The plastic material carries UL recognition 94V-0

MECHANICAL DATA
Case : JEDEC A-405 molded plastic
Polarity : Color band denotes cathode
Weight : 0.008 ounces, 0.22 grams
Mounting position : Any
